How to choose

Think about pedal feel and how much direct feedback you want from your foot when choosing a hi-hat stand.

Beginner

A newer drummer can start with a Stage Master Hi-hat Stand, which is stable and straightforward for learning basic hi-hat patterns. Adjust the spring tension gradually as your foot technique develops.

Intermediate

A drummer refining their technique can move to an Iron Cobra 200 or Speed Cobra 310 stand for smoother, more precise pedal action. Try different tension settings to match your playing style.

Expert

A drummer wanting the most direct pedal feel can use the Dyna-Sync stand, which drives the hi-hat clutch without a chain or cable. Keep the mechanism clean and lubricated, and check the double-braced legs regularly on stands used for heavier playing.
